BENOIT v. ZONING BOARD OF APPEALS


148 Conn. 443 (1961)

THOMAS BENOIT ET AL. v. ZONING BOARD OF APPEALS OF THE TOWN OF ENFIELD ET AL.

Supreme Court of Connecticut.

Decided June 6, 1961.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ert B. Berger, with whom was Charles B. Alaimo, for the appellants (plaintiffs).

Paul M. Palten, with whom, on the brief, was Charles Alfano, for the appellees (defendants Maggio et al.); with him also were Leroy E. Schober and, on the brief, Walter Dudek, for the appellee (named defendant).

BALDWIN, C. J., KING, MURPHY, SHEA and ALCORN, JS.


BALDWIN, C. J.

The plaintiffs are property owners claiming to be aggrieved by the action of the defendant zoning board of appeals, which in 1958 granted a variance of the zoning ordinance of the town of Enfield on the petition of the defendants Alice M. Maggio and Stop and Shop, Inc. Alice M. Maggio operated a grocery store at 500 Enfield Street, where she sold beer under a grocery store beer permit. See General Statutes § 30-20 (c).
